Joe Russo (born July 18, 1971) is an American filmmaker with his brother, Anthony Russo, collectively known as the Russo brothers (/ˈruːsoʊ/ ROO-soh). They direct most of their work together. They are best known for directing four films in the Marvel Cinematic Universe (MCU): Captain America: The Winter Soldier (2014), Captain America: Civil War(2016), Avengers: Infinity War (2018), and Avengers: Endgame (2019). Endgame grossed over $2.798 billion worldwide, briefly becoming the highest-grossing film ever.
The brothers have also worked as directors and producers on the comedy series Arrested Development (2003–2005), Community (2009–2014), and Happy Endings (2011–2012). They won a Primetime Emmy Award for Arrested Development.
